Market Overview
Fortified dairy products are enriched with essential nutrients like vitamin D, calcium, vitamin A, and probiotics to meet consumer nutritional needs. The global demand is rising due to:
- Growing health-conscious population
- Increased prevalence of vitamin and mineral deficiencies
- Rising disposable income in developing regions
- Product innovation and enhanced flavors
According to recent market research, the fortified dairy products market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6.29% from 2026 to 2035, reaching a value of $54.5 billion by 2035.
Key Market Drivers
- Health Awareness: Consumers are looking for functional foods that support immunity, digestion, and bone health.
- Technological Advancements: New fortification techniques preserve nutrients without affecting taste or texture.
- Product Innovation: Fortified dairy snacks, beverages, and yogurts cater to busy lifestyles.
- Government Initiatives: Nutritional programs in schools and hospitals encourage fortified dairy consumption.

Market Segmentation
The market can be segmented by:
- Product Type: Fortified milk, yogurt, cheese, butter, and other dairy products.
- Distribution Channel: Supermarkets, convenience stores, online retailers, and specialty stores.
- Geography: North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East & Africa.
Among these, fortified milk remains the most popular product type, while Asia-Pacific is the fastest-growing region due to increasing urbanization and health-focused consumer behavior.
Market Challenges
- Higher production costs due to fortification
- Limited consumer awareness in rural regions
- Shelf-life concerns for fortified dairy products
Opportunities in the Market
- Plant-based fortified dairy alternatives: Gaining traction as a combination of health and sustainability.
- E-commerce channels: Providing convenient access and targeted marketing to consumers.
- Collaborations: Partnering with nutritionists and healthcare brands to improve consumer trust and adoption.
